Marzanabad (Persian: مرزن آباد, also Romanized as Marzanābād, Marzūnābād,and Murzānābād)[1] is a city in Kelardasht District, in Chalus County, Mazandaran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 5,078, in 1,335 families.[2]

Marzanabad is the closest green city of Mazandaran province to Tehran while passing through the beautiful road of Tehran-Chalus. Note that Tehran-Chalus road is one of three major roads that connect Tehran to Mazandaran province and it is the shortest path towards Caspian Sea from Tehran.

Marzanabad is located on a T-junction of the roads towards Tehran, Chalus and Kelardasht. It is about 25 km away from both Chalous and Kelardasht while it is about 170 km away from Tehran via Tehran-Chalus road. It worths to mention that after completing Tehran-Chalous highway first phase (Tehran-Shahrestanak phase), the distance will be reduced to 110 km. Due to the strategic location of the city, it attracts thousands of tourists each year from almost all parts of Iran, but especially from Tehran.
